Question
∠1 and ∠2 are complementary angles. if m∠1 = (4x + 12)° and m∠2 = (3x - 6)°, then find the measure of ∠2.
Step1: Use the property of complementary angles
Complementary angles sum to \(90^{\circ}\). So, \(m\angle1 + m\angle2=90^{\circ}\).
Substitute \(m\angle1=(4x + 12)^{\circ}\) and \(m\angle2=(3x - 6)^{\circ}\) into the equation:
\((4x + 12)+(3x - 6)=90\)
Step2: Simplify the left - hand side of the equation
Combine like terms:
\(4x+3x+12 - 6=90\)
\(7x + 6=90\)
Step3: Solve for \(x\)
Subtract \(6\) from both sides:
\(7x=90 - 6\)
\(7x=84\)
Divide both sides by \(7\):
\(x=\frac{84}{7}=12\)
Step4: Find the measure of \(\angle2\)
Substitute \(x = 12\) into \(m\angle2=(3x - 6)^{\circ}\)
\(m\angle2=(3\times12-6)^{\circ}\)
\(m\angle2=(36 - 6)^{\circ}\)
\(m\angle2 = 30^{\circ}\)
